The medicare levy is currently 2% of your taxable income, however you may be entitled to a reduction (or even pay no levy at all) if you meet certain low income thresholds. In addition to the Medicare levy, a surcharge of between 1% to 1.5% is added if you don’t have private hospital cover and your taxable income is above a prescribed amount.
